10/9 Samardzija to start in Mexico
Jeff Samardzija didn’t get much of an offseason. The right-hander was scheduled to start Friday night for Mexicali against Hermosillo in the Mexican League opener. Iowa manager Bobby Dickerson is the Mexicali skipper, and Samardzija will have three other Cubs Minor Leaguers on the roster in Brian Schlitter, Matt Camp and Brad Snyder.
Samardzija’s last start for the Cubs on Oct. 1 was rained out. The right-hander gave up three runs over three innings before nature intervened. He finished 1-3 with a 7.53 ERA in 20 games, including two starts.
“The kid needs to pitch Winter Ball,” Lou Piniella said after Samardzija’s last outing. “He’s on the right path. He just needs to work on the things he’s working on and get more consistent with it and Winter Ball will give him that opportunity.”
The right-hander is a candidate for a spot in the Cubs’ rotation in 2010.
